Hitchcock Season would rule because he's one of the all-time greats w/a plethora of classics, *but* also he has some stinkers in there *and* his relationship w/women both behind and in front of the camera (which contrast in fascinating ways depending on the film) is probably some of the most fertile ground for your analysis after the Bond films. Oh, and since I started listening to this I've been wondering when you'll get to North By Northwest, which was both deliberately intended as the culmination of Hitchcock's spy thrillers going back to The 39 Steps, and subsequently quite blatantly used as the model for the first decade of Bond films to the point that Hitchcock was annoyed w/his friend Albert R. Broccoli for ripping him off so blatantly; even just looking at that film would be great for that context, a full Hitchcock season that allowed you to see how much the thriller/escapist genres were shaped by his films would be sublime.
